Home
last modified time | relevance | path

Searched refs:dev_a (Results 1 – 5 of 5) sorted by relevance

/titanic_44/usr/src/uts/i86pc/io/gfx_private/
H A Dgfxp_segmap.c64 struct segdev_crargs dev_a; in gfxp_ddi_segmap_setup() local
141 dev_a.mapfunc = mapfunc; in gfxp_ddi_segmap_setup()
142 dev_a.dev = dev; in gfxp_ddi_segmap_setup()
143 dev_a.offset = (offset_t)offset; in gfxp_ddi_segmap_setup()
144 dev_a.type = flags & MAP_TYPE; in gfxp_ddi_segmap_setup()
145 dev_a.prot = (uchar_t)prot; in gfxp_ddi_segmap_setup()
146 dev_a.maxprot = (uchar_t)maxprot; in gfxp_ddi_segmap_setup()
147 dev_a.hat_attr = hat_attr; in gfxp_ddi_segmap_setup()
149 dev_a.hat_flags = 0; in gfxp_ddi_segmap_setup()
151 dev_a.hat_flags = HAT_LOAD_LOCK; in gfxp_ddi_segmap_setup()
[all …]
/titanic_44/usr/src/uts/common/io/
H A Dmem.c802 struct segdev_crargs dev_a; in mmsegmap() local
844 dev_a.mapfunc = mmmmap; in mmsegmap()
845 dev_a.dev = dev; in mmsegmap()
846 dev_a.offset = off; in mmsegmap()
847 dev_a.type = (flags & MAP_TYPE); in mmsegmap()
848 dev_a.prot = (uchar_t)prot; in mmsegmap()
849 dev_a.maxprot = (uchar_t)maxprot; in mmsegmap()
850 dev_a.hat_attr = 0; in mmsegmap()
864 dev_a.hat_flags = HAT_LOAD_NOCONSIST; in mmsegmap()
865 dev_a.devmap_data = NULL; in mmsegmap()
[all …]
/titanic_44/usr/src/uts/common/vm/
H A Dseg_dev.c2402 struct segdev_crargs dev_a; in ddi_segmap_setup() local
2457 dev_a.mapfunc = mapfunc; in ddi_segmap_setup()
2458 dev_a.dev = dev; in ddi_segmap_setup()
2459 dev_a.offset = (offset_t)offset; in ddi_segmap_setup()
2460 dev_a.type = flags & MAP_TYPE; in ddi_segmap_setup()
2461 dev_a.prot = (uchar_t)prot; in ddi_segmap_setup()
2462 dev_a.maxprot = (uchar_t)maxprot; in ddi_segmap_setup()
2463 dev_a.hat_attr = hat_attr; in ddi_segmap_setup()
2464 dev_a.hat_flags = 0; in ddi_segmap_setup()
2465 dev_a.devmap_data = NULL; in ddi_segmap_setup()
[all …]
/titanic_44/usr/src/uts/common/os/
H A Dmmapobj.c581 struct segdev_crargs dev_a; in mmapobj_unmap() local
587 dev_a.mapfunc = mmapobj_dummy; in mmapobj_unmap()
588 dev_a.dev = makedevice(mm_major, M_NULL); in mmapobj_unmap()
589 dev_a.offset = 0; in mmapobj_unmap()
590 dev_a.type = 0; /* neither PRIVATE nor SHARED */ in mmapobj_unmap()
591 dev_a.prot = dev_a.maxprot = (uchar_t)PROT_NONE; in mmapobj_unmap()
592 dev_a.hat_attr = 0; in mmapobj_unmap()
593 dev_a.hat_flags = 0; in mmapobj_unmap()
596 segdev_create, &dev_a); in mmapobj_unmap()
/titanic_44/usr/src/uts/common/fs/specfs/
H A Dspecvnops.c2256 struct segdev_crargs dev_a; in spec_segmap() local
2292 dev_a.mapfunc = mapfunc; in spec_segmap()
2293 dev_a.dev = dev; in spec_segmap()
2294 dev_a.offset = off; in spec_segmap()
2295 dev_a.prot = (uchar_t)prot; in spec_segmap()
2296 dev_a.maxprot = (uchar_t)maxprot; in spec_segmap()
2297 dev_a.hat_flags = 0; in spec_segmap()
2298 dev_a.hat_attr = 0; in spec_segmap()
2299 dev_a.devmap_data = NULL; in spec_segmap()
2301 error = as_map(as, *addrp, len, segdev_create, &dev_a); in spec_segmap()